- Shorov algoritam omogućuje rastavljanje velikih brojeva na faktore, što ugrožava trenutne sustave šifriranja.
- Grover ubrzava pretraživanja u nestrukturiranim bazama podataka pomoću proširenja širine.
- Idealni kubiti obećavaju rješavanje NP-teških problema kao što je trgovački putnik za transformaciju optimizacije.
U posljednjem desetljeću, kvantni algoritmi Napravili su revoluciju u području računalstva, nudeći rješenja koja su se prije činila nedostižnima s klasična računala. Ovi algoritmi iskorištavaju prednosti jedinstvenih svojstava kubita, kao što su slaganje i zapetljanost, za izvođenje složenih izračuna na mnogo učinkovitiji način. efikasan nego tradicionalni pristupi.
U ovom ćemo članku istražiti glavni pojmovi, aplikacije i izazovi povezani s kvantni algoritmi. Od poznatih Shorov algoritam gore Nedavni napredak kao što je korištenje jednog kubita za rješavanje složenih problema i Googleov algoritam kvantnih odjekaIstražit ćemo kako ovi alati preoblikuju područja kao što su kriptografijaje optimizacija i znanost o podacima.
Shorov algoritam i njegov utjecaj na kriptografiju
El Shorov algoritam je možda jedan od kvantni algoritmi najpoznatiji po svojoj sposobnosti faktorizacije velike brojke u polinomnom vremenu. Ovaj exploit je predstavljao ozbiljne prijetnje trenutnim sustavima šifriranja, kao što su RSA, koji ovise o težini faktoriziranja velikih prostih brojeva. Dok je a klasično računalo Rješavanje ovog problema moglo bi potrajati godinama, kvantno računalo Pokretanjem Shorovog algoritma, to možete postići u nekoliko sekundi.
Ovaj se algoritam temelji na dvije glavne faze: klasičnoj fazi redukcije problema faktoringa na traženje razdoblje i kvantni stupanj gdje kvantna Fourierova transformacija. Ovaj posljednji korak je ključan jer nam omogućuje da pronađemo period funkcije u vremenu. efikasan. Međutim, fizička implementacija algoritma zahtijeva izuzetno male kubite. stabilan i precizno, nešto što trenutni kvantni sustavi još uvijek usavršavaju i u čemu projekti poput QnodeOS Oni rade.
Najnoviji napredak: primarni faktori i idealni kubiti
Unatoč teoretski napredak Shorovog algoritma, njegova praktična implementacija je ograničena. Najveći broj faktoriziran ovim algoritmom u a kvantno računalo do danas je 21, zbog trenutnih tehnoloških ograničenja. Međutim, očekuje se da će ti izazovi biti prevladani kako qubiti postižu više viša kvaliteta i stabilnost.
Problemi povezani sa Shorovim algoritmom
- Ograničenje u klasičnim sustavima: Iako je Shorov algoritam revolucionaran za kvantna računala, metode kao što su Kvadratno sito najbolje rade na tradicionalnim računalima.
- Tehnološki izazovi: Implementacija zahtijeva qubits od visoka vjernost i sustavi sposobni za izvođenje unitarnih transformacija s krajnja preciznost.
Groverov algoritam i pretraživanje u nestrukturiranim bazama podataka
Još jedan stup kvantno računanje je Groverov algoritam, dizajniran za ubrzavanje pretraživanja u nestrukturiranim bazama podataka. Dok bi klasično računalo zahtijevalo vrijeme proporcionalno broju ulaznice Grover je u bazi podataka uspijeva svesti na kvadratni korijen ukupnog broja unosa, što predstavlja značajna prednost.
Ovaj algoritam koristi kvantne tehnike kao što su pojačanje amplitude povećati izgledi pronaći željeni rezultat. Na primjer, pronalaženje jednog ispravnog ključa među 100 opcija zahtijeva samo pokušaj 10 puta u prosjeku, u usporedbi s do 100 pokušaja u klasičnom sustavu.
Praktične primjene ovog algoritma
- Optimizacija NP-potpunih problema putem iscrpnog pretraživanja.
- Brzo razrješenje problemi kolizije u kriptografskim sustavima.
- Učinkovit pristup na velike količine podataka.
Unatoč njegovom prednostiGroverov algoritam ne zamjenjuje klasične metode u svim područjima, ali nadopunjuje specifične zadatke koji iskorištavaju njegovu sposobnost rukovanja složenim podacima.
Rješavanje NP-teških problema s kubitima
Obećavajuće područje na kvantno računanje je rješavanje NP-teških problema kao što su problem trgovačkog putnika (TSP), koji pronalazi najkraći put između niza gradova. U nedavnom pristupu, istraživači su pokazali kako idealan qubit može implementirati ovaj algoritam rotacije na Blochovoj sferi, predstavljajući gradove kao točke na spomenutoj sferi.
Iako su početne simulacije pokazale obećavajuće rezultate za do 9 gradova, tehnološki izazovi Sadašnji pristupi ograničavaju njihovu primjenu za veće probleme. On kvantni paralelizam povezani s ovim rješenjima mogli bi revolucionirati optimizaciju matematika i logistike u bliskoj budućnosti.
Budućnost kvantnih algoritama
La kvantno računanje je u svojim ranim fazama, ali kontinuirani razvoj algoritmi kao što su Shorov i Groverov, kao i nove primjene u područjima kao što su umjetna inteligencijaje računalna biologija i kvantni internet, ukazuju na svijetlu budućnost. Ključ će biti nadvladati trenutna tehnološka ograničenja, kao što su kvaliteta i stabilnost kubita, te dizajnirati hardver koji može podržati zahtjeve ovih naprednih algoritama.
desde la kriptografija do optimizacija, ono što se nekada činilo nemogućim sada nam je nadohvat ruke zahvaljujući napretku u kvantni algoritmi. Iako je pred nama još dug put, nema sumnje da smo pred tehnološkom transformacijom koja će obilježiti prije i poslije u više znanstvenih i tehnoloških disciplina.